ORDER

0/„ 25.09.2019 1.

These are applications under Section 438 of the Code of Criminal Procedure, 1973 for grant of anticipatory bail. 2.

Learned counsel for the petitioners submitted that the son of the petitioners, namely, Ashish, one of the accused, has already been granted bail by the Trial Court vide order dated 1.8.2019. Learned APP does not deny this fact. 3.

Status report has been filed, wherein it is stated that, on 7.4.2019, a call was received at PS; Nihal Vihar, Delhi regarding suicide committed by the sister of the caller at

H.No.A-26, Gali No.3, Shiv Ram Park, Nangloi, Delhi. The ASI reached at the place of incident and found one lady in an unconscious state, and on inquiry, it was found that Smt. Rajbala, daughter of Ram Dass had committed suicide. She was admitted to the hospital, where she was declared brought dead. The statement of the father of the deceased was recorded, wherein he stated that the husband of the deceased used to beat his daughter.

4.

Taking into consideration status report filed by the State as well as the allegations made against the petitioners and the grant of bail to one of the accused, this Court deems it proper that the petitioners, in the event of their arrest, be released on furnishing personal bonds till 30.9.2019, in the sum of Rs.20,000/, with one surety each of the like amount to the satisfaction of the lO/SHO. However, if need of arrest arises thereafter, the 10 shall give five working days notice to the petitioners so that they may avail the legal remedy. Meanwhile, the petitioners are directed to Join and cooperate in the investigation, as and when called by the lO/SHO in writing; that they shall not involve in any activity which may prejudice the prosecution or the witnesses.

5.

Bail applications are disposed of.
